Previously, China's agriculture, agriculture and agriculture released a report that the northeast region of the mainland is now a busy season for spring ploughing, which is also a critical period for cultivated land sowing. However, recently, China Sannong has been receiving letters from netizens in Kailu County, Inner Mongolia, saying that someone has forcibly prevented them from farming, and they are anxious about it. And those who blocked the spring ploughing were the town cadres of Jianhua Town and the village cadres of Shuangsheng Village.

On the evening of 23 April, the Information Office of the Kailu County Government said that Kailu County had dismissed the deputy secretary of the town's party committee and given him an intra-party warning by the county Commission for Discipline Inspection and Supervision.

The video shows that some farmers in Shuangsheng Village, Jianhua Town, Kailu County, have jointly contracted more than 5,000 mu of land from the village collective, with a contract period until 2034. Now, during the busy season of spring ploughing, the town and village cadres prevent them from going to the fields to cultivate. The villagers' hired farming machinery was stopped by the village committee and others, and some cadres in the town seized the villagers' agricultural machinery, claiming that the land no longer belonged to the villagers.

In an interview with the media, relevant legal experts said that the village committee should bear the responsibility of foreseeing the risks in this incident, and that the villagers should invest in improving the land at a cost, and their rights and interests should be protected by law.

In response, the Information Office of the Kailu County Government said that the background of the problem reflected in the report is that Kailu County, as a pilot unit for the efficient use of new cultivated land determined by the superiors, has carried out pilot work on the efficient use of cultivated land newly increased by the "third adjustment of national land" compared with the "second adjustment of national land";

According to the Information Office of the Kailu County Government, during the implementation of the pilot project in Shuangsheng Village, Jianhua Town, some large new cultivated land households were unwilling to pay fees, resulting in the comparison psychology of farmers who had already paid fees, which led to the obstruction of land ploughing. At present, through the coordination and resolution of the county, town and village levels, the people of the village have agreed to take the form of litigation to claim their rights and interests, resolve contradictions, and ensure that there are no more behaviors that hinder land ploughing and land preparation, delay agricultural time, etc.

According to the circular, Kailu County has dismissed the deputy secretary of the town's party committee and given him an intra-party warning by the county discipline inspection commission and supervision committee; the county discipline inspection commission and supervision committee have given serious intra-party warnings to the secretary of the village's party branch and deputy director of the village committee.
